A Latin webfont is forty kilobytes. A Japanese one covering the same text is several megabytes, because it has to carry thousands of characters.
The typography is the performance budget.
Nothing else on a Japanese page comes close to the weight of the type, and most advice about web fonts was written for alphabets.
Fonts subsetted to the characters used
A full Japanese font carries thousands of glyphs and weighs megabytes. Subsetting to the characters a page actually contains turns the largest asset on the site into one of the smaller ones.

What we change for Japanese sites
One fact dominates: the writing system needs thousands of glyphs, and shipping all of them is the default.
| Setting | What we do | Why |
|---|---|---|
| Font delivery | Subsetted to the characters each page uses | A complete Japanese face carries thousands of glyphs and runs to megabytes, making it larger than every image on the page combined. |
| Font loading | Sequenced so text is readable before the face arrives | A multi-megabyte font blocking first paint leaves a Japanese page blank for exactly as long as the download takes. |
| Origin region | Placed in Asia rather than fronted by an Asian edge | Cached pages are served locally either way, but signed-in and transactional pages always reach the origin wherever it happens to be. |
| Markup caching | Full HTML cached rather than assembled in the browser | Japanese layout features reflow differently from Latin text, so client-side assembly settles visibly in front of the reader. |
| Data handling | Stated for APPI including cross-border movement | Japan's regime asks specifically what happens when data leaves the country, which is a question about facts rather than about a provider's region names. |
